Cost Comparison
Direct booth costs are just the entry fee. The total cost of exhibiting includes design, shipping, team travel, accommodations, and marketing. Exhibiting in Nairobi versus Taipei may involve significantly different travel and lodging expenses, which can swing the total investment by thousands of dollars.
Calculate cost per qualified lead for each event. The show with the lower booth rental is not always the better investment. A more expensive show that delivers higher-quality leads may generate a better return per dollar spent.
